Mapping and Monitoring Urban Ecosystem Services Using Multitemporal High-Resolution Satellite Data. |
Abstract | ||
---|---|---|
This study aims at providing a new method to efficiently analyze detailed urban ecological conditions at the example of Shanghai, one of the world's most densely populated megacities. The main objective is to develop a method to effectively analyze high-resolution optical satellite data for mapping of ecologically important urban space and to evaluate ecological changes through the emerging ecosys... |
